Carl Edwards ended up taking home the win at Charlotte on Sunday which ended his 31 race win less streak. According to CBS Sports, Carl's last win took place at the Food City 500 in Bristol in 2014 after a rain shortened race.

This weekend's Coca Cola 600 was also Edward's first win since joining a new team this season, Joe Gibbs Racing

After the race, CBS caught up with Edwards:

I've been stressed, I'm so competitive, and I'm not happy with how we've performed and the results we've had. I feel like this is a gift. This is truly a gift.

The rest of the race's results include Greg Biffle in his Ford, Dale Jr, Matt Kenseth, and Martin Truex Jr rounding out the top 5, reported by NASCAR.
